Description

Christian Norberg-Schulz, world-renowned Norwegian historian and theorist of architecture, in his most famous book with impressive photographic accompaniment, reveals the conditions and causes of the placement, emergence, and forms of cities based on an analysis of the entire system of circumstances that accompany the centuries-long development of the urban organism. He does not shy away from philosophical and ethical questions associated with cities as human settlements. He demonstrates his theoretical foundations through the analysis of three different cities: Rome, Prague, and Khartoum. He introduces a classification of landscapes, architecture, and cities – Rome is the prototype of the classical city, Prague of the romantic, and Khartoum of the cosmic. The book has been translated into many languages and continues to be published worldwide.
